The Truman National Security Project seeks a motivated Data Manager to provide technical and human support for effective data input, management, and access across our organization. Our ideal candidate will thrive in a start-up environment, have data management and non-profit experience, and a strong record of success in managing data for public outreach, membership, or targeted advocacy campaigns. The ability to be extremely responsive to staff while working on different projects in a fast-paced environment is required.
Basic Functions:
- Manage, organize, and maintain the Truman Project’s Salsa database that supports our leadership development and advocacy programs.
- Maintain and improve data organization structures to ensure the Truman Project website displaying and information properly to the user.
- Work directly with Truman staff to understand their data needs and help them deliver results.
- Improve data collection, entry, and reporting systems to improve efficiencies and work closely with staff to develop and implement data management procedures.
- Manage membership lists and perform basic data manipulation and reporting via Microsoft Excel.
- Coordinate timelines and activities for multiple projects at once.
- Work directly with Truman staff and senior leadership to design collection and reporting methods for program evaluation data.
- Limited network management and IT support.
QUALIFICATIONS:
- Experience with Excel and file manipulation in Windows a must.
- Strong interpersonal and communication skills.
- Familiarity with CMS systems such as Salsa, VAN, and NGP.
- Diplomatic, professional approach to problem solving while working independently or as part of a team.
- Ability to manage several tasks and projects concurrently and prioritize work effectively.
- Exceptional attention to detail.
- Strong commitment to Truman values.
